How is customer delivery on time (cDOT) calculated?

Customer delivery on time (cDOT) is calculated by taking half the total delivery trip time and adding half the age of the order. This formula accounts for both the time taken to deliver the order as well as the age of the order itself, providing a comprehensive view of the delivery performance. By incorporating both elements, cDOT reflects how timely the delivery was relative to when the order was placed, which is crucial for assessing customer satisfaction.

Using just the total delivery trip time or the average delivery time for all orders does not consider the specific context of each individual order, nor does it factor in how long the customer has been waiting. Therefore, the combination of total delivery time and order age offers a more nuanced metric for evaluating delivery efficacy.
